Abstract
The utility model discloses a kind of section drawing devices, multiple clamping devices including transport mechanism and installation on the transfer mechanism;The transport mechanism includes conveyer belt, installation conveying mechanism on a moving belt, and the conveying mechanism includes that more root knot structures are identical and the delivery roll of installation on a moving belt;Multiple clamping devices pass through delivery roll and uniformly arrange on a moving belt along the direction of motion of conveyer belt.The utility model can effectively draw profile;The utility model is clamped and is drawn to profile using vacuum chuck, and the damage and extrusion deformation to profile are effectively avoided;The utility model is effectively avoided in distraction procedure, profile is worn using the through slot for being provided with rubber spacer;The utility model greatly reduces the proportion of goods damageds of product, effectively reduces production and operation cost.

Background technique
After profile extrusion molding, the ancillary equipment of rear end aluminum profile after molding is needed to draw outward, traditional traction
Device is worked using vehicle-mounted hydraulic station driving equipment, but hydraulic device is at high cost, be easy to cause failure, and elevating mechanism is with hydraulic fixed
The positioning of position is also inaccurate;It usually can be profile compressive strain since pressure is difficult to control using vehicle-mounted hydraulic station feeding clip mechanism.
